Origin story
The group’s arc began with an IT services foundation and enterprise asset-handling experience, then grew through Dev IT as an operational base. That work exposed a recurring failure: procurement, asset movement, recovery, and end-of-life were being managed as separate events instead of one accountable lifecycle.
The system emerged from operational gaps, not brand architecture.
Deshwal emerged as the compliance and certified end-of-life layer, bringing recycling infrastructure, documentation discipline, and responsible processing into the lifecycle.
OxyPC was built to control intake, custody, and routing before assets disappeared into fragmented vendor channels.
Renew Circuits was built to recover value from assets that still had utility instead of treating exit as loss.
Together, OxyPC and Renew Circuits completed the intake, routing, and recovery layers that connect asset exit back to enterprise accountability.
BlueMonk unified these layers into one controlled lifecycle system.
The 22-year arc matters because this system could not have been assembled quickly. It had to be built stage by stage.
Problem solved
Enterprise IT assets moved through multiple vendors, internal teams, service providers, refurbishers, and recyclers without one accountable system owning the full movement.
Multiple vendors operating around the same asset
No single owner across procurement, recovery, and disposal
Traceability breaking between internal use and external movement
Audit-ready documentation created late, inconsistently, or not at all
Enterprises were managing processes. No one was owning the lifecycle.
System evolution
Each company was built to solve a specific failure point — then integrated into one system.
Stage 1
Dev IT / BlueMonk Tech
OEM-backed infrastructure sourcing, deployment, support, and managed use begin the asset record.
Stage 2
OxyPC
Asset exit enters a controlled intake layer with custody, condition, and routing visibility.
Stage 3
Renew Circuits
Eligible devices are tested, graded, refurbished, and directed to accountable reuse outcomes.
Stage 4
Deshwal
Assets that cannot be recovered move into certified recycling, data destruction, and documentation.
